Search Press Watercolour Landscapes for the Absolute Beginner by Matthew Palmer

In Watercolour Landscapes for the Absolute Beginner, artist and teacher Matthew Palmer guides beginners through their first steps in watercolour and shows what incredible landscapes can be achieved in this exciting medium. Matthew explains how to work from photos, how to do a basic sketch, how to apply colour and washes, and how to construct a scene in manageable steps. Even if you are already aware of these, his clear explanations can offer fresh perspectives, and he is especially knowledgeable on the fundamentals of perspective. Before moving on to more difficult projects, which each come with a pre-printed outline, a series of brief activities will quickly familiarise you with the basics of skies, water, and trees. This book contains material previously published in Matthew Palmer’s Step-by-Step Guide to Watercolour Painting (2018) and also has an accompanying DVD, “Venice by Night with Matthew Palmer” (MPWLBD), available separately.
